Monday Box Office Verdict: War 2 Collapses, Coolie Drops big, Mahavatar Narsimha Stays Strong 

 

The extended Independence Day weekend saw three heavyweights clashing at the box office, War 2 from the YRF Spy Universe, Rajinikanth Coolie and the animated phenomenon Mahavatar Narsimha. While expectations were monumental, the Monday numbers have made the picture very clear.

War 2 Crashes Hard on Monday

War 2 enjoyed a massive holiday push with 28 crore nett on Thursday and peaked at 45 crore on Friday. However, the momentum fizzled quickly as Saturday and Sunday fell to 26 crore and 25.5 crore respectively. Its extended four-day weekend stood at 125 crore nett.

But the real test came on Monday, and the film crashed outright. With just about 6.5 crore nett in Hindi (8.5 crore all languages) the drop is close to 75% in top chains like PVR, INOX and Cinepolis, with mass centres showing an even sharper decline. Several multiplex shows, including IMAX, were cancelled due to no audiences and zero occupancy  and now many screens are already being handed over to Narsimha.

The five-day total of War 2 is around 131 crore nett, and the first week will barely cross 145 crore. Lifetime business is looking capped in the 160 crore range, cementing its place among YRF’s biggest failures alongside Thugs of Hindostan. 

Mahavatar Narsimha Stays Unstoppable

If one film is rewriting box office history, it is Mahavatar Narsimha. Even in its fourth Monday, the animated epic collected a superb 1.8 crore nett, taking its Hindi total to around 164 crore nett. Nationwide, the film has already crossed the 200 crore nett mark and is still running strong with extraordinary holds.

With War 2 collapsing, many screens have been reassigned to Narsimha, further boosting its run. The film is expected to sustain superbly through the weekdays and may well finish close to 200 crore nett in Hindi alone.

Coolie Suffers Big Hindi Drop, Stable in the South

Coolie – The Powerhouse is doing steady if unspectacular business in Hindi. After its extended weekend haul of 19 crore nett, the film added just 1.5 crore nett on Monday, (12 crore all languages)  bringing its Hindi total to around 20.5 crore nett. The film saw a sharp drop in Hindi markets, indicating limited interet in the North and West. The Hindi lifetime is heading towards the 30–35 crore nett range in hindi. 

However, the real strength of Coolie lies in the South markets. Rajinikanth and Lokesh Kanagaraj’s fanbase has ensured strong numbers in Tamil Nadu, Karnataka, Kerala, and Andhra Pradesh/Telangana. The film is a clear winner in the South but has turned into a disappointment in the Hindi belt.
